The No-Registration Flow: Does It Actually Work?
Yes. It works. But it is not magic. The concept is simple: you use a payment method (like Trustly or a specific e-wallet) that acts as your identity. The casino creates a “ghost account” linked to that payment method. You deposit, you play, you withdraw. No username, no password. You get a session token instead.
I tested this with a £50 deposit using a Visa debit card. The money hit the balance in about 4 seconds. I was at a blackjack table within 60 seconds of landing on the site. That is fast. For a UK player who is sick of the KYC dance, this is a massive win.
However, here is the contradiction. When you eventually win (I turned that £50 into £187 on a lucky streak of baccarat), the withdrawal process is not instant. You still need to verify your identity before they release the cash. So “play instantly” is true. “Cash out instantly” is a different story. That is the trade-off. You get speed on the front end, patience on the back end.

Can I really play without registering?
Yes. You deposit using a payment method. The system creates a temporary player ID. You do not create a username or password. Your session is tied to your payment method. It is a “pay and play” model. It is legal in the UK under a UKGC license.
Is the site safe for UK players?
It is licensed by the UK Gambling Commission. I checked the license number. It is valid. Your funds are held in a separate account. It is not a rogue site. It is a regulated operator. That gives me some peace of mind.
What happens if I win a lot of money?
You will need to complete full KYC (Know Your Customer) verification before you can withdraw. This is a legal requirement for UKGC casinos. You will need to upload ID and proof of address. It takes a few hours to a day. You cannot bypass this. So do not think you can win £10,000 and disappear. You cannot.
